英英词典释义
  • Noun
    1. an act that fails;
    "his failure to pass the test"
    2. an event that does not accomplish its intended purpose;
    "the surprise party was a complete failure"
    3. lack of success;
    "he felt that his entire life had been a failure""that year there was a crop failure"
    4. a person with a record of failing; someone who loses consistently
    5. an unexpected omission;
    "he resented my failure to return his call""the mechanic's failure to check the brakes"
    6. inability to discharge all your debts as they come due;
    "the company had to declare bankruptcy""fraudulent loans led to the failure of many banks"
    7. loss of ability to function normally;
    "kidney failure"
